Oracle 10g RAC x86 Solaris10 安装全攻略
需积分: 3 73 浏览量
更新于2024-07-27
收藏 4.08MB DOC 举报
"Oracle 10g RAC for x86 Solaris10 安装指南,由Aaron Zhou提供,详述在Solaris 10 X86平台上的Oracle 10g RAC集群数据库安装步骤,包括系统环境、前期配置、安装过程及创建集群数据库的步骤。"
在Oracle 10g RAC (Real Application Clusters)的环境中,多个服务器共享同一数据库实例,提供高可用性和负载均衡。本指南针对的是在基于Intel Xeon处理器的Sun服务器上运行的Solaris 10操作系统。硬件配置包括两台S4250服务器、一台Sun Storage 6140和千兆交换机,以及光纤卡连接的存储设备。
在安装Oracle 10g RAC之前,需要对系统进行一系列的配置工作:
1. **创建Oracle用户和用户组**:首先,需要删除旧的Oracle用户和相关的用户组,然后创建新的用户组`oinstall`(用于安装过程)和`dba`(用于数据库管理),并分配相应的GID。接着,创建`oracle`用户,将其设置为`dba`用户组的成员,并设定合适的shell路径。这个过程要在每个节点上执行。
2. **权限设置**:确保`oracle`用户拥有必要的权限,例如对安装目录的读写权限,以及对网络和存储设备的访问权。通常,这涉及到修改文件和目录的权限以及设置适当的SELinux或SMF策略。
3. **网络配置**:在RAC中,每个节点需要至少有两个网络接口,一个用于常规网络通信,另一个用于Oracle Interconnect(节点间的高速通信)。配置IP地址、子网掩码、主机名和DNS解析,确保节点间能互相识别。
4. **共享存储**:Oracle RAC需要共享存储来存取数据文件。在本案例中,两台S4250节点通过光纤卡直接连接到Storage 6140,实现存储共享。配置好光纤通道(FC)连接,确保存储可以被所有节点访问。
5. **Oracle Grid Infrastructure (GI) 安装**:GI是RAC的基础,包含Clusterware和ASM(Automatic Storage Management)。首先在所有节点上安装GI,这一步骤涉及软件包的解压、配置响应文件、运行安装脚本等。
6. **数据库实例安装**:在GI安装完成后,可以安装数据库软件。通过`oracle`用户执行DB installation,指定RAC类型,配置数据库参数如SID、监听端口等。
7. **创建Cluster数据库**:使用`crsctl`和`sqlplus`等工具,创建并启动RAC数据库。这包括设置数据库名称、表空间、初始化参数文件等,同时使用`crsctl`命令启动和注册数据库服务。
8. **验证和测试**:安装完成后,进行系统和网络验证,如ping测试、OCR(Oracle Cluster Registry)和Voting Disks的检查,以及数据库的连接测试,确保一切正常。
以上步骤详细阐述了Oracle 10g RAC在Solaris 10 X86系统上的部署过程,每一步都需要谨慎操作,以保证RAC环境的稳定和高效运行。在实际操作中,可能还会遇到如软件兼容性、网络延迟、存储性能等问题,需要根据具体情况调整和优化。
2019-03-21 上传
点击了解资源详情
2009-03-20 上传
点击了解资源详情
点击了解资源详情
2010-03-27 上传
2010-10-24 上传
jinshariver
- 粉丝: 0
- 资源: 6
最新资源
- Angular实现MarcHayek简历展示应用教程
- Crossbow Spot最新更新 - 获取Chrome扩展新闻
- 量子管道网络优化与Python实现
- Debian系统中APT缓存维护工具的使用方法与实践
- Python模块AccessControl的Windows64位安装文件介绍
- 掌握最新*** Fisher资讯,使用Google Chrome扩展
- Ember应用程序开发流程与环境配置指南
- EZPCOpenSDK_v5.1.2_build***版本更新详情
- Postcode-Finder:利用JavaScript和Google Geocode API实现
- AWS商业交易监控器:航线行为分析与营销策略制定
- AccessControl-4.0b6压缩包详细使用教程
- Python编程实践与技巧汇总
- 使用Sikuli和Python打造颜色求解器项目
- .Net基础视频教程:掌握GDI绘图技术
- 深入理解数据结构与JavaScript实践项目
- 双子座在线裁判系统:提高编程竞赛效率